Key features and quick specs
Thoughtfully configured for performance and comfort, this Cabo offers one cabin and one head, sleeping four in climate‑controlled ease. Draft is 3'05" and beam spans 15'09", set over a substantial 28,000 lbs. Displacement is matched to generous tankage with 550 gallons of fuel and 95 gallons of fresh water, while a bow thruster enhances close‑quarters control. Anglers will appreciate the prep and rigging station, a cockpit center bait tank complemented by a Bluewater cockpit bait tank, a cockpit freezer, and large tackle storage. A full tower with complete controls and steering works in concert with RUPP outriggers and Furuno touchscreen electronics to elevate the hunt offshore. Endurance is assured by a watermaker, and ownership simplicity is underscored by an LLC title. Power comes from MAN 800 HP engines showing approximately 3600 hours, supported by a Westerbeke 8 kW generator to keep systems humming at anchor or underway.
Galley
The galley is finished with sleek Corian countertops and equipped for serious onboard cuisine, featuring a two‑burner electric cooktop and a micro/convection oven. An AC/DC refrigerator/freezer keeps provisions perfectly chilled, while abundant cabinetry and clever compartments swallow dry goods and cookware with ease, ensuring everything is at hand when the bite turns into dinner.
Stateroom
The private stateroom centers on an inviting island V‑berth, with large storage drawers beneath and a portside hanging locker for neatly stowed attire. Natural light and airflow pour through a foredeck hatch with shade, and there is direct access to the anchor locker. Comforts include a 15" flat‑screen TV, dedicated rod storage lockers, and efficient AC/heat to tailor the climate to every season.
Head
The well‑appointed head features a Sealand Vacuflush electric toilet, a vanity with mirror, and Corian countertops that elevate the finish. A separate stall shower offers true home‑style convenience, while a storage cabinet keeps toiletries orderly and out of sight.
Electronics
Command is effortless from the main helm with two Furuno NavNet TZ Touch Black Box 19" screens, complemented by a Furuno NavNet TZ 14" display. The suite expands with Furuno 1920C, 1934C, DFFI, BBWXI, and sea surface temperature, a Furuno Black Box sounder, and a Furuno Black Box 4' open‑array radar for long‑range target definition. Precision steering comes via a Simrad AP70 autopilot at the helm, an RD33 in the tower, and a Simrad AP26 with ACR2 feedback and compass. Offshore communications and awareness are elevated by a Seatel 14" Coastal Satellite DSS antenna, two Shakespeare 16' VHF antennas new in 2020, FLIR thermal imaging, two Icom M604 at the helm in the MIC tower, and an ACR2 station spotlight to pierce the night.
Electrical
Power is cleanly managed through 24VDC and 120VAC distribution, with a 50A 125/250V shore power inlet and Glendinning Cable Master for effortless cord handling. An 8 kW Westerbeke generator supplies reliable ship’s power underway or on the hook. Practical touches include AC power outlets in the engine room and electric fuel priming pumps to streamline starts after service.
Mechanical
Long‑range autonomy is supported by a watermaker, while four bilge pumps stand vigilant for safety. Electronic engine controls with trolling valves deliver precise low‑speed maneuvering on the bite, and an oil change system simplifies routine maintenance. Hot water is on tap thanks to an 11‑gallon water heater, adding a welcome residential touch offshore.
Deck and cockpit
Purpose‑built for battle and comfort, the deck carries a full tower with controls and steering and a West Coast bow rail for confident movement forward. In the cockpit, a bait prep station and tackle center pair with a 48‑gallon center bait tank and an additional Bluewater cockpit bait tank, while a cockpit freezer, large macerated fishboxes in the cockpit deck, and rod/gaff storage to port and starboard keep the spread organized. Day‑to‑day luxury includes an icemaker in the starboard helm‑deck cabinet, a hot/cold handheld deck shower, cockpit courtesy lighting, and canvas covers for the helm and Stidd chairs. Access to the machinery is excellent via an engines access hatch and a hydraulic lifting helm floor for full engine access. Three Stidd helm seats and a 24,000 BTU helm‑deck air‑conditioning system complete a helm that is equal parts command center and lounge.
Propulsion
Twin MAN D2876LE423 diesel engines from 2008 provide the heartbeat of the Cabo 40 Express, each delivering a total power of 596.56 kW, translating the brand’s reputation for torque and durability into authoritative, efficient performance.
